After trying to upgrade to Ubuntu 14, I'm unable to restart my computer. It takes me to error "Reboot and select proper boot device".
After googling around, it seems that others have encountered similar problems. The steps I took to try and fix this were:
1) created a bootable USB with Ubuntu 14 from my mac
2) started the computer with the bootable USB and hit "Try Ubuntu"
3) connected to internet and installed boot-repair
4) ran boot-repair with following paste
http://paste.ubuntu.com/10695782/
The boot-repair said it was "successful" and told me to try and reboot my computer. Unfortunately I'm running into the same problem.
